    Disc brakes with gyro

    BMX brake levers pull less cable than V-brake or cable disc brake levers. The Gyros made for BMX brakes will probably not have enough throw. An option is to run an Avid BB7 road caliper, which is the same as the BB7 mountain caliper but with a shorter throw arm for the lower cable pull, and some...

  6. C

    Bleeding 3 week old Avid brakes?

    The good thing about Avids is that they're very easy and quick to bleed. The problem is that they require a variation on the normal bleed technique in order to extract all the air from under the reservoir bladder. The Avid kit is pretty cheap, the instructions are good. Some Avids come OEM...

  13. C

    Lacing Wheelsets?

    Doing a straight swap from one rim to another is easier than lacing from scratch. Just zip tie the new rim next to the old one, with the valve holes aligned, and swap the spokes over. Be sure to loosen the spokes evenly from the old rim before removing any entirely. Tensioning the new wheel...
